[123 ] I think it is necessary to tell you that BYD’s blade battery, the blade battery is not a new battery type, but the shape of the battery. Essentially is also a lithium iron phosphate battery. The blade battery is flattened by a single cell and thinner thickness.
With a traditional cylindrical battery, there will be more gaps after stacking, and the space utilization is not high. The blade battery is increased by no gaps and the spatial utilization rate. So BYD’s blade battery can increase energy density in unit volume, or less volume without increasing density.
Since the BYD’s blade battery is essentially a lithium iron phosphate battery substance, it has some advantages and disadvantages of the lithium iron phosphate battery. The advantage is that the price is low, and the price of Tesla Model 3 with lithium iron phosphate batteries is also cheap.
